William Hemmelgarn
William "Bill" Roman Hemmelgarn died Feb. 5, 2023.
He was born on August 10, 1942 in New Weston, OH to Clem H. and Julia (Saalman) Hemmelgarn. He was married to MaryLou (Schacht) Hemmelgarn for 51 years.
Survived by Daughter Leslie & Jerome Muhlenkamp, Fort Recovery, OH and Son Greg & Kelly Hemmelgarn, Portland, IN; Grandkids, Grant Muhlenkamp, Gabriel Muhlenkamp, Valerie Muhlenkamp, all of Fort Recovery, OH and Finn Hemmelgarn, Tuck Hemmelgarn & Sawyer Hemmelgarn, all of Portland, IN. And 3 great-grandchildren with 1 on the way. Also survived by sister Marlene Knapke, Coldwater, OH and brother David Hemmelgarn, Portland, IN.
Proceeded in death by his parents, and brothers Thomas Hemmelgarn and Larry Hemmelgarn.
He owned and operated his farm in rural Portland, IN and worked for Avco New Idea in Coldwater, OH for 42 years until his retirement in 2002. After retirement he drove truck for Cooper Farms until 2011. He was a great dad who like to play ball in the yard, shoot basketball, take walks in the family woods, ride bikes, swim, ride his Gator or 4 wheeler. He was always up for an adventure and we loved to play jokes on him. He always had a great laugh and everyone knew him by that. He loves playing with the grandkids and watching their sporting events. He will be sadly missed.
There will be no arrangements, just a private family affair at some point. Please keep him in your Prayers.
